Slitting saw blades play a crucial role in precision cutting, especially in industries like metal fabrication, automotive, and manufacturing. Whether you are using a Slitting Saw or a Metal Slitting Saw, maintaining optimal performance and extending tool life is essential for efficiency, cost savings, and high-quality results. Poor maintenance or incorrect usage can lead to premature wear, reduced accuracy, and frequent replacements. Here are some practical tips to help you improve the performance and lifespan of your slitting saw blades.
Selecting the correct Slitting Saw for your application is the foundation of performance. Different materials require different blade compositions, tooth designs, and coatings. For instance, high-speed steel (HSS) blades are ideal for general-purpose cutting, while carbide-tipped blades are better suited for harder materials. Using the wrong blade can cause excessive wear, overheating, and poor cutting results.
One of the most common mistakes in using a Metal Slitting Saw is incorrect cutting speed and feed rate. Running the blade too fast can generate excessive heat, leading to dull edges and potential damage. On the other hand, a feed rate that is too slow can cause rubbing instead of cutting, reducing efficiency. Always follow manufacturer recommendations and adjust based on the material being cut.
Accurate alignment is essential for achieving clean cuts and prolonging blade life. Misalignment can cause uneven wear, vibration, and even blade breakage. Make sure the Slitting Saw is mounted securely and aligned correctly with the workpiece. Regularly check machine components such as arbors and spacers to ensure stability during operation.
Heat is one of the biggest enemies of any Metal Slitting Saw. Without proper cooling, blades can overheat, lose hardness, and wear out quickly. Using cutting fluids or coolants helps reduce friction, dissipate heat, and improve cutting efficiency. Proper lubrication also prevents chip buildup, which can negatively impact performance.
A dull Slitting Saw not only reduces cutting quality but also puts extra stress on the machine and the blade itself. Regular sharpening ensures that the blade maintains its cutting efficiency. It is important to use professional sharpening services or proper grinding equipment to maintain the correct tooth geometry.
Tooth pitch plays a significant role in the cutting process. A Metal Slitting Saw with too many teeth can clog with chips, while too few teeth may result in rough cuts. Choose a tooth pitch that matches the thickness and type of material being cut. Proper chip evacuation helps reduce heat and wear on the blade.
Applying excessive force during cutting can damage the Slitting Saw and reduce its lifespan. Let the blade do the work instead of forcing it through the material. Overloading can lead to tooth breakage, bending, and reduced precision. Consistent and controlled feeding ensures smoother operation and longer tool life.
Chip accumulation and debris can affect the performance of a Metal Slitting Saw. After each use, clean the blade thoroughly to remove any metal particles or coolant residues. A clean blade ensures better cutting accuracy and prevents corrosion or damage over time.
Proper storage is often overlooked but plays a vital role in maintaining blade quality. Store your Slitting Saw blades in a dry, clean environment to prevent rust and contamination. Use protective covers or cases to avoid accidental damage and keep the edges sharp.
The condition of your cutting machine directly impacts the performance of your Metal Slitting Saw. Worn-out machine parts, loose components, or excessive vibration can lead to poor cutting results and faster blade wear. Regular maintenance of the machine ensures smooth operation and consistent performance.

Even the best Metal Slitting Saw cannot perform well if not used correctly. Proper training for operators ensures that they understand the correct setup, cutting parameters, and maintenance practices. Skilled handling reduces errors, improves safety, and maximizes blade life.
